• 240 ECTS/4years of education

• Supervised clinical training included

Biomedical Laboratory Scientists Education in

Portugal

Health Profession %

Biomedical Laboratory Scientists 0,08

Doctors 0,52

Dentists 0,10

Nurses 0,72

Pharmaceuticals 0,13

Health Professionals out of all Portuguese population - 2017

Biomedical Laboratory Scientists in Portugal where we work?

• Laboratory Hospitals public and private

• Private laboratories

• Research

• Industry

(8)

8

Biomedical Laboratory Scientists in Portugal where what we do?

• Public health

• Hematology

• Transfusion and transplantation

• Microbiology

• Clinical Biochemistry

• Blood collection

• Histopathology

• Morphology

• Citopathology

• Forensic Sciences

• Flow cytometry

• Molecular Biology
